I am little late like normal, but let's be real Aloalan Marowak has potential to beat most (if not all) the ultra beast due to his typing and ability.  Game freak's way to balance these monsters was limiting the move pool meaning a very low lack of coverage, they are easy to predict, and while the Ultras can run some sets to boost their stats toy unreal levels, they just don't have coverage to beat their checks which forces switches and thus lose of stat boosts. There is is just low coverage, you need to bank on getting K.Os to continue a sweep, that can skyrocket your stats. On paper they are ridiculous, but in practice they can be beat, pretty easily. Toxipexs tho.....

The mere fact that they force every team to run dedicated counters for them is unhealthy for the metagame.

Marowak-A and Toxapex have such high usage right now because they serve as counterweight. 

Therefore the previously vast ORAS metagame will steadily become limited due to centralization.

 

Things like Pheromosa and Xurkitree break the metagame and I believe will be the first to go. Kartana might follow.

Nihilego, Buzzwole and Celesteela might as well stay in OU. 

There is also that Dark/Dragon mon nobody cares about, which will probably fall in BL or UU.

True, this is the number one reason why things ban, but there are still some poekmon that can take on the beast. Dragonite it a good candidate, banded E-speed kills pheromosa at 100, the D-Dance set is also a good choice too. Priority is what can keep them in check because if they can't get a knockout, they pretty much die because of their paper defense. I am sure once bank comes out they will stay OU. Now it is still up for debate, but they can be beaten. Basically if you can hit it hard with priority, you can win.

You have a point, but  Comfey who has a better healing move which gains priority (+3) thanks to triage and aromatherapy which definitely helps with status moves would make it a better support mon. Granted ribombee is faster with some good stab offensive moves as well as the capability of having aromatherapy as well, it's bug typing gives it a slight disadvantage comparing it to comfey because of the additional weaknesses which are more apparent in the meta of rock sliding heat waving spammers. While Ribombee may have the advantage in its god tier `124 base speed' its more frail than Comfey comparing its 60/60/70  defences to 51/90/110 defences of Comfey.

 

Comfey also has access to Grassy Terrain which can help to remove the terrain brought by other Tapu's barring Bulu, but most importantly it can remove the annoying psychic terrain of Tapu Lele at will which could be valuable depending on the situation.

quite right about comfey, i will agree it is the more flexiable choice but ribombee still has a niche role it can fill, due to it being able to learn both light screen or reflect you can set up some defenses to cover yourself as you attempt to set up a quiver dance/support your tank mon via pollen puff. here is an example set you can run for it

Timid nature, 252 speed, 252 special attack, 4 defense. Moves : light screen/reflect, quiver dance, pollen puff, dazzling gleam. and for items you have a few options in bugium z or fairyum z or you can opt to run choice specs and swap out quiver dance and your screen move slot for energy ball and psychic but i lean in favor of bugium z since if you do z quiver dance it restores your health giving you added survivalbility on what would be an otherwise frail af mon. 

 

i mean also with ribombee you can remove added affects from moves, which can make or break a situation if say your opponent is running a power up punch life orb lucario, that lucario wouldn't get the set up it wants to sweep.  

 

but i see where you are coming at with comfey, it is fast and has decent defense but that flaw it has is if it gets poked it dies with that abysmal health stat, it will not be healing long if it can't get some sort of a defense up. So maybe it will be smart to run ribombee and comfey together? they can support each other with their signature healing moves and ribombee's speed can allow a screen to be set up followed by comfey setting up grassy terrain. Then after that ribombee quiver dances and heals comfey when needed and comfey keeps ribombee topped off till you can dazzling gleam your foe to death.
